You are inAccommodations in Spain

Hotels in Torres de Albarracín

We offer 4+ holiday rentals in Torres de Albarracín

Show maps Dates Guests Amenities Apartments

All our hotels in Torres de Albarracín

Hotel Torres de Albarracin

new

Hotel- Restaurante TORRES

new
Select the dates of your stay